The LMH2121 is an accurate fast-responding power detector / RF envelope detector. Its response between an RF input signal and DC output signal is linear. The typical response time of 165 ns makes the device suitable for an accurate power setting in handsets during a rise time of RF transmission slots. •2 Linear Response
• 40 dB Power Detection Range
• Very Low Supply Current of 3.4 mA
• Short Response Time of 165 ns
• Stable Conversion Gain of 3.6 V/VRMS
• Multi-Band Operation from 100 MHz to 3 GHz
• Very Low Conformance Error
• High Temperature Stability of ±0.5 dB
• Shutdown Functionality
• Supply Range from 2.6V to 3.3V
• Package:
– 4-Bump DSBGA, 0.4mm Pitch
